Renter-friendly buildings in Dyker Heights

Dyker Heights is a residential neighborhood in Brooklyn, known for its single-family homes and access to parks, making it a good choice for families. The area features 843+ buildings, providing a variety of living options to potential renters. With a community-oriented atmosphere, Dyker Heights has a reputation for maintaining a quiet environment, making it appealing to many. What to check before for renter-friendly buildings in Dyker Heights

  • Confirm any pet policies, fees, and breed/size restrictions if applicable.
  • Review building amenities and note any additional fees or restrictions involved before signing a lease.
  • Ask about the length of lease terms along with any penalties for early termination.
  • Consider the overall costs including utilities, broker fees, and deposits beyond just rent.
  • Verify the building's condition and maintenance history for a more informed rental experience.
